On April 15th, we alerted on Assembly Bill 2571, a bill to prohibit “marketing” firearms and ammunition to children. As discussed previously, this reach of this broadly written prohibition will likely ensnare hunter education programs and firearm safety training for youth. Unfortunately, this draconian bill passed the Assembly Privacy and Consumer Protection Committee April 19th.
The next step is a hearing in the California Assembly Judiciary Committee on April 26th. It is imperative that sportsmen and women contact committee members and let them know you oppose this bill because of the unintended consequences it will likely have. There are no exemptions in the bill for education or related instruction.
